Subject: Re: [PATCH] mm/page_owner: Remove drain_all_pages from init_early_allocated_pages

>> This warning is showed because we are calling drain_all_pages() in
>> init_early_allocated_pages(), but mm_percpu_wq is not up yet,
>> it is being set up later on in kernel_init_freeable() -> init_mm_internals().
>
> I _think_ the patch is correct. The changelog should explain, _why_
> removing drain_all_pages is OK. Joonsoo what was the reason to put it
> here in the first place? I do not see any real reason. This is an init
> code and we shouldn't have any pages on those caches anyway. Moreover I
> fail to see why the fact they are on the pcp caches mattered at all.

I also _think_ the patch is correct. My intention is to move all the
free page from the pcp
to the buddy since init_early_allocated_pages() tries to distinguish
allocated page by
checking the buddy flag. However, this is an init code and batch
counter of the pcp would
be zero so there would be no free page on pcp.
